    I thought that too when I was watching in person but I think beginning in the 2nd Qtr the defense began stunting and sending people. Ferguson was extremely unlucky in that on his two biggest sacks..............

    PLAY 1) Jacob Gilliam, who is not an SEC Tackle, failed to pick up the invert (Swafford) who he either did not see pre-snap or just didn't give a shit about.

    PLAY 2) Ray Raulerson didn't make an attempt to engage ANYONE much less the man who buried his QB and Jalen Hurd did not pick up the change in protection.

    To identify why the other QBs did not have the same problems ( the other 3 were possibly more demonstrative pre-snap) i'll have to wait and see the complete film in a few days :eek: . Regardless, something clearly was different when the other 3 were out there and I am very interested in finding out.
